What is CNC Turning?
Computer Numerical Control (CNC) turning is a process where raw materials are shaped into desired parts through cutting, drilling, or milling. This technology employs a computer program to control the movement of the machinery, ensuring that every piece produced is consistent and precise. Key Advantages of CNC Turning Services
- Enhanced Precision: CNC turning provides unmatched precision compared to manual machining, reducing the likelihood of human error.
- Increased Efficiency: Automated processes allow for rapid production, meeting tight deadlines without sacrificing quality.
- Versatility: This service can accommodate a wide range of materials, including metals and plastics, making it ideal for various industries.
- Cost-effectiveness: Reducing waste and optimizing material usage translates to significant cost savings in the long term.
Industries Benefiting from CNC Turning Services
Numerous sectors leverage cnc turning service to streamline their production processes. Key industries include:
- Aerospace: The aerospace sector requires parts that adhere to strict tolerances and regulations.
- Automotive: Precision components are vital for vehicle performance and safety, making CNC turning a necessity.
- Medical Devices: Manufacturing tools and implants require exacting standards met through advanced machining techniques.
- Electronics: Small components often need intricate designs that CNC turning can efficiently replicate.
